Output e862513d7c0ed789c2813e36d7c7ae31568b297601c1e558011364e583eafb72:5

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c46b31754133f271e237c0a4177903ed648352b OP_EQUAL
address
3BZXbZ5wMyiMCDF3USq1FQNjZ6KFRkgfcs
transaction
e862513d7c0ed789c2813e36d7c7ae31568b297601c1e558011364e583eafb72
spent
true